123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185186187188189190191192193194195196197198199200201202203204205206207208209210211212213214215216217218219220221222223224225226227228229230231232233234235236237238239240241242243244245246247248249250251252253254255256257258259260261262263264265266267268269270271272273274275276277278279280281282283284285286287288289290291292293294295296297298299300301302303304305306307308309310311312313314315316317318319320321322323324 |
- package com.jsh.erp.datasource.entities;
- import com.jsh.erp.datasource.vo.UnitListVo;
- import io.swagger.annotations.ApiModelProperty;
- import lombok.Data;
- import lombok.experimental.Accessors;
- import java.math.BigDecimal;
- import java.text.SimpleDateFormat;
- import java.util.Date;
- import java.util.List;
- @Data
- @Accessors(chain = true)
- public class MaterialVo4Unit extends Material{
- private String unitName;
- private BigDecimal ratio;
- private String categoryName;
- private String materialOther;
- private BigDecimal stock;
- private BigDecimal purchaseDecimal;
- private BigDecimal commodityDecimal;
- private BigDecimal wholesaleDecimal;
- private BigDecimal lowDecimal;
- private BigDecimal billPrice;
- private String mBarCode;
- private String commodityUnit;
- private Long meId;
- private BigDecimal initialStock;
- private BigDecimal currentUnitPrice;
- private BigDecimal currentStock;
- private BigDecimal currentStockPrice;
- private BigDecimal currentStockMovePrice;
- private BigDecimal currentWeight;
- private String sku;
- // private Long depotId;
- /**
- * 换算为大单位的库存
- */
- private String bigUnitStock;
- /**
- * 换算为大单位的初始库存
- */
- private String bigUnitInitialStock;
- private String imgSmall;
- private String imgLarge;
- @ApiModelProperty("生产日期")
- private String productionDate;
- @ApiModelProperty("供应商id")
- private Long supplierId;
- @ApiModelProperty("商品条码")
- private String barCode;
- @ApiModelProperty("批次号")
- private String batchNumber;
- @ApiModelProperty("库存")
- private BigDecimal inventory;
- @ApiModelProperty("仓库id")
- private Long depotId;
- @ApiModelProperty("仓位货架")
- private String position;
- @ApiModelProperty("供应商名称")
- private String supplierName;
- @ApiModelProperty("仓库名称")
- private String depotName;
- @ApiModelProperty("实际出入库数量")
- private String actualQuantityInStorage = "";
- @ApiModelProperty("出入库差异")
- private String warehousingVariance = "";
- @ApiModelProperty("出入库差异原因")
- private String reasonOfDifference = "";
- @ApiModelProperty("出入库用户")
- private String warehousingUser = "";
- @ApiModelProperty("出入库时间")
- private String warehousingTime = "";
- @ApiModelProperty("多单位集合")
- private List<UnitListVo> unitList;
- public String getUnitName() {
- return unitName;
- }
- public void setUnitName(String unitName) {
- this.unitName = unitName;
- }
- public BigDecimal getRatio() {
- return ratio;
- }
- public void setRatio(BigDecimal ratio) {
- this.ratio = ratio;
- }
- public String getCategoryName() {
- return categoryName;
- }
- public void setCategoryName(String categoryName) {
- this.categoryName = categoryName;
- }
- public String getMaterialOther() {
- return materialOther;
- }
- public void setMaterialOther(String materialOther) {
- this.materialOther = materialOther;
- }
- public BigDecimal getStock() {
- return stock;
- }
- public void setStock(BigDecimal stock) {
- this.stock = stock;
- }
- public BigDecimal getPurchaseDecimal() {
- return purchaseDecimal;
- }
- public void setPurchaseDecimal(BigDecimal purchaseDecimal) {
- this.purchaseDecimal = purchaseDecimal;
- }
- public BigDecimal getCommodityDecimal() {
- return commodityDecimal;
- }
- public void setCommodityDecimal(BigDecimal commodityDecimal) {
- this.commodityDecimal = commodityDecimal;
- }
- public BigDecimal getWholesaleDecimal() {
- return wholesaleDecimal;
- }
- public void setWholesaleDecimal(BigDecimal wholesaleDecimal) {
- this.wholesaleDecimal = wholesaleDecimal;
- }
- public BigDecimal getLowDecimal() {
- return lowDecimal;
- }
- public void setLowDecimal(BigDecimal lowDecimal) {
- this.lowDecimal = lowDecimal;
- }
- public BigDecimal getBillPrice() {
- return billPrice;
- }
- public void setBillPrice(BigDecimal billPrice) {
- this.billPrice = billPrice;
- }
- public String getmBarCode() {
- return mBarCode;
- }
- public void setmBarCode(String mBarCode) {
- this.mBarCode = mBarCode;
- }
- public String getCommodityUnit() {
- return commodityUnit;
- }
- public void setCommodityUnit(String commodityUnit) {
- this.commodityUnit = commodityUnit;
- }
- public Long getMeId() {
- return meId;
- }
- public void setMeId(Long meId) {
- this.meId = meId;
- }
- public BigDecimal getInitialStock() {
- return initialStock;
- }
- public void setInitialStock(BigDecimal initialStock) {
- this.initialStock = initialStock;
- }
- public BigDecimal getCurrentUnitPrice() {
- return currentUnitPrice;
- }
- public void setCurrentUnitPrice(BigDecimal currentUnitPrice) {
- this.currentUnitPrice = currentUnitPrice;
- }
- public BigDecimal getCurrentStock() {
- return currentStock;
- }
- public void setCurrentStock(BigDecimal currentStock) {
- this.currentStock = currentStock;
- }
- public BigDecimal getCurrentStockPrice() {
- return currentStockPrice;
- }
- public void setCurrentStockPrice(BigDecimal currentStockPrice) {
- this.currentStockPrice = currentStockPrice;
- }
- public BigDecimal getCurrentStockMovePrice() {
- return currentStockMovePrice;
- }
- public void setCurrentStockMovePrice(BigDecimal currentStockMovePrice) {
- this.currentStockMovePrice = currentStockMovePrice;
- }
- public BigDecimal getCurrentWeight() {
- return currentWeight;
- }
- public void setCurrentWeight(BigDecimal currentWeight) {
- this.currentWeight = currentWeight;
- }
- public String getSku() {
- return sku;
- }
- public void setSku(String sku) {
- this.sku = sku;
- }
- // public Long getDepotId() {
- // return depotId;
- // }
- //
- // public void setDepotId(Long depotId) {
- // this.depotId = depotId;
- // }
- public String getBigUnitStock() {
- return bigUnitStock;
- }
- public void setBigUnitStock(String bigUnitStock) {
- this.bigUnitStock = bigUnitStock;
- }
- public String getImgSmall() {
- return imgSmall;
- }
- public void setImgSmall(String imgSmall) {
- this.imgSmall = imgSmall;
- }
- public String getImgLarge() {
- return imgLarge;
- }
- public void setImgLarge(String imgLarge) {
- this.imgLarge = imgLarge;
- }
- public String getBigUnitInitialStock() {
- return bigUnitInitialStock;
- }
- public void setBigUnitInitialStock(String bigUnitInitialStock) {
- this.bigUnitInitialStock = bigUnitInitialStock;
- }
- public void setProductionDate(Date productionDate) {
- S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");
- String date = productionDate == null ? null : sdf.format(productionDate);
- this.productionDate = productionDate == null ? null : date;
- }
- }
|